WebAug 21, 2024 · Probabilities provide a required level of granularity for evaluating and comparing models, especially on imbalanced classification problems where tools like ROC Curves are used to interpret predictions and the ROC AUC metric is used to compare model performance, both of which use probabilities. WebJan 6, 2024 · The area under the ROC curve ( AUC) represents the ability of the classifier (or test) to produce a higher score for an actual positive than an actual negative— i.e., the (underlying) ability to discriminate positives from negatives according to the score (properly called a classification score).

WebFeb 17, 2024 · Is AUC a good metric for Imbalanced data? Although generally effective, the ROC Curve and ROC AUC can be optimistic under a severe class imbalance, especially when the number of examples in the minority class is small. In this case, the focus on the minority class makes the Precision-Recall AUC more useful for imbalanced classification problems.
